Types of Fireplaces
Before diving into the very best options available, it's vital to comprehend the kinds of fireplaces you can pick from:
TypeDescriptionProsConsWood-BurningBurns logs or pellets, providing a traditional aesthetic.Authentic heat and atmosphere.Needs more upkeep and logs storage.GasUses natural gas or propane.Cleaner than wood and easy to run.Less authentic feel than wood.ElectricOffers heat without combustion, using electricity.Easy installation and requires very little upkeep.Lacks the authentic feel of a genuine fire.BioethanolBurns bioethanol fuel, developing a genuine flame with minimal ecological effect.Eco-friendly and elegant.Lower heat output and requires fuel refills.Pellet StovesAutomatic feeders that burn compressed wood pellets.Effective and environment-friendly.More costly upfront and requires electricity.Best Fireplaces in the UK1. Timeless design with a big glass window.Top quality workmanship.Easy to control the burn rate.Key Factors to Consider When Choosing a Fireplace
Size and Space: The fireplace's size ought to complement your room without frustrating it. Measure the area offered and pick a fireplace designed for that location.

Fuel Type: Consider how you want to utilize your fireplace-- whether you choose the credibility of wood, the benefit of gas, or the ease of electric.

Installation: Some fireplaces require professional setup while others can be set up DIY. Consider your skill level and budget plan for installation.

Budget plan: Fireplaces can vary from a couple of hundred to numerous thousand pounds, depending on the type and brand name. Set a reasonable spending plan before you begin shopping.

Performance: Look for fireplaces that boast high energy efficiency scores. This will save you money in the long run on fuel expenses.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)Q1: What is the most efficient kind of fireplace?
A1: Electric fireplaces are generally 100% effective, as all the energy they use is converted into heat. Nevertheless, modern-day wood-burning and gas ranges can likewise be very efficient, with scores typically above 75%.
Q2: Do I need planning permission to set up a fireplace?
A2: It depends on local regulations and the type of fireplace. Generally, a wood-burning or gas fireplace might require preparation consent or structure policies approval, especially in noted buildings. It's constantly best to contact your local council.
Q3: What is the life-span of a fireplace?
A3: A well-kept fireplace can last for several years. Electric fireplaces can last a lifetime with minimal maintenance, while wood and gas fireplaces may require more upkeep and replacement of parts over time.
Q4: Can I set up an electric fireplace myself?
A4: Yes, lots of electrical fireplaces are developed for simple installation and can typically be set up without expert help. Nevertheless, it's necessary to follow the maker's guidelines carefully.
Q5: What's the finest fireplace alternative for a little space?
A5: Electric fireplaces, especially wall-mounted systems, are perfect for small spaces as they can be set up without taking up flooring space. Selecting a compact wood or gas stove might also be a practical solution.
